Yemen primarily experiences two main seasons: a hot summer and a mild winter. The summer, which lasts from May to September, can be extremely hot, especially in the lowland areas. The winter season, from October to April, is generally cooler and wetter, particularly in the highland regions. Additionally, some areas may experience a brief spring and autumn, though these are less distinct.
